National Commission for Women to open Premarital Counseling Centre in every district of the country

The National Commission for Women (NCW) has said that it will open a Premarital Counseling Centre in every district of the country. Talking to the media in Patna, NCW Chairperson Vijaya Rahatkar said this is a new initiative of the commission launched on International Women’s Day this year. She said 23 such centres have been opened in 11 states so far.
 
The Chairperson said these counseling centres will be opened at government spaces and it will be operated under the supervision of district or municipal bodies. Mrs. Rahtakar said these pre-marital centres will help those couples who are going to tie the knot. The Chairperson said that the centre counsel will provide help regarding social psychology and behavioral aspects of marriage. She added that rising marital disputes, divorce cases, and failed marriages are issues of concern as joint families are disintegrating into nuclear families.
